The <i>Staphylococcus intermedius</i> group of bacterial pathogens: species re‐classification, pathogenesis and the emergence of meticillin resistance
1 Oct 2009
Abstract excerpt
Staphylococcus intermedius has been long regarded as the common cause of pyoderma in dogs and other animals. Despite its clinical importance, our understanding of the population genetics and pathogenesis of S. intermedius is limited.
